Output ecb265d159a36e752f1d099f16730329d379b2b18d735a46818eb1113b54f35e:5

value
9486720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b7978262092f9acf5dfed6f3b622f59dd667a62 OP_EQUAL
address
MEnERevLGkEq6drxZuaBwxbvDqCquoVk5M
transaction
ecb265d159a36e752f1d099f16730329d379b2b18d735a46818eb1113b54f35e
spent
true